Largest discretionary spending increase since Jimmy Carter, Omnibus Appropriations Act of 2009

Omnibus 2009 Issues


H.R. 1105, better know as the Omnibus Appropriations Act of 2009, contains a total of nine appropriation bills with a price tag of $410.0 billion. Investor's Business Daily states that this amounts to an increase of 8% over last year, making it the largest discretionary spending increase since Jimmy Carter. The Democrats waited nearly five months to finish writing this bill, knowing that President Bush would refuse to sign it with the provisions they wanted.
